Nashville TN Real Estate - Bradford Hills and Holt Woods
June 2011 Market Report

Sales have been all over the board this past 12 months in Bradford Hills and Holt Woods. The past 3 months have been the most active with an average of over 3 closings each month. We've combined the two neighborhoods in this report to give you a clear picture of what is happening in our immediate area.
| Market Activity in the Past - | 3 Months | 6 Months | 12 Months |
| Closed Transactions | 11 | 12 | 24 |
| Average # homes sold each month | 3.67 | 2 | 2.08 |
| Active listings in the Neighborhood | 29 | 29 | 29 |
| Months supply of inventory | 7.9 | 14.5 | 14 |
Of the Bradford Hills and Holt Woods 29 homes listed Active for Sale, 2 have inspection contingencies. There are 2 Short Sales in the Active listings.
There is one Pending.
If this current trend continues, we will be able to declare the market is stable in this neighborhood. A market is considered stable when it has no more than 6 months supply of inventory.
The First Quarter of this year started slow with no closings until March. The average Sales Price has increased just over 1% in the past 12 months and the Days on the Market decreased from 107 to 77.
